We have posted MacEchoTelem, a telemetry program for Macintosh computers
running OS X 10.3 or above on the website. You can read about it at:
http://www.amsat.org/amsat-new/echo/MacEchoTelem.php
MacEchoTelem will capture, decode and display KISS data received from Echo
via your 9600 baud TNC and your Macintosh computer. It will produce the
necessary .csv files to upload to the Echo Telemetry Database.
MacEchoTelem is provided free of charge by Dog Park Software, specifically
through the efforts of Don Agro VE3VRW and Gilbert Mackall N3RZN. It is
also available via the Dog Park Software at:
